Summary
The description of what users are looking at is inconsistent in our language describing the interface.

Description
On the page for creating a newsletter the opening starts with "This page allows you to create a new newsletter". On the page for unsubscribing it states, "This interface allows you to unsubscribe from "Tech Showcase" newsletter." Emphasis added.

We should pick one way of describing what users are looking at. Is it a "page" or is it an "interface". I suggest the former, "page", as it's more common of a word and sounds less technical than "interface".
